Songs Without Words Or Sound

Evan Patterson (Jay Jayle, Young Widows, so many more) has a new book out and a solo exhibition. The book features 70 b/w pen & ink illustrations. The first 90 will come with a signed and numbered print in either metallic copper or charcoal. The showing will be at the Darby Forever Gallery inside Surface Noise, with an opening on April 5th from 6-9pm. Walk Alone releases new s/t EP

Before you head out to the LDB Fest, make sure to check out this new release from Walk Alone. Reforming after a nearly 12 year absence for the LDB pre-show, Walk Alone is hitting 2024 hard with a newly recorded 6 song blast barely topping 8 minutes. Guitarist Keith Lucius let it be known that tracks 1,2, and 4 are all new songs, with the balance being re-recorded versions of songs from the 2012 demo.
